  • Viktor Vasilievich Zhluktov (Russian: ?????? ?????????? ???????) (born January 26, 1954) is a retired Russian ice hockey player who played for CSKA Moscow and the Soviet Union. In the 1976 Canada Cup, Zhluktov scored 5 goals and 4 assists in 5 games, tying him for both the most points (with Bobby Orr and Denis Potvin) and goals (with Milan Nový and Bobby Hull) in the tournament, despite playing two fewer games than the players he tied with. For a while he played in the same line-up as Vladimir Krutov, Sergei Makarov, Viacheslav Fetisov and Alexei Kasatonov before Igor Larionov replaced him.
